About Aeris Partners
Aeris Partners is a market-leading boutique investment bank that provides strategic M&A advisory services to best-in-class software, Software-as-a-Service (SaaS), data & analytics, private equity, and venture capital firms spanning a range of high-growth vertical markets. Aeris leverages extensive technology domain expertise and an unparalleled commitment to delivering superior M&A outcomes on every transaction while maintaining a commitment to fostering a positive, collaborative, inclusive, entrepreneurial, and team-oriented firm culture. The firm's senior leadership team has successfully completed more than $40 billion of M&A advisory assignments to date with transactions ranging from $200 million to $2 billion in enterprise value.
Aeris is a registered broker-dealer and member of FINRA and SIPC.
We are seeking high calibre pre- and post-MBA Vice Presidents with exceptional leadership, communication, teamwork, client-facing, and analytical skills, and an unwavering passion for excellence. Vice Presidents work directly with Managing Directors during all facets of the M&A advisory transaction life cycle, including transaction development, transaction execution and transaction negotiation and strategy. Specific responsibilities include assisting with the preparation of market and operating analyses, information memoranda, marketing presentations, and financial and valuation analyses. Vice Presidents support Directors and Managing Directors during all phases of M&A execution, including supervising and developing Analysts, contributing to firm best practices and culture, and building industry relationships.

What you need to know about the Boston Tech Scene
Boston is a powerhouse for technology innovation thanks to world-class research universities like MIT and Harvard and a robust pipeline of venture capital investment. Host to the first telephone call and one of the first general-purpose computers ever put into use, Boston is now a hub for biotechnology, robotics and artificial intelligence — though it’s also home to several B2B software giants. So it’s no surprise that the city consistently ranks among the greatest startup ecosystems in the world.
Key Facts About Boston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 269,000; 9.4%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Toast, Klaviyo, HubSpot, DraftKings
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robotics, software, aerospace
- Funding Landscape: $15.7 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Summit Partners, Volition Capital, Bain Capital Ventures, MassVentures, Highland Capital Partners
- Research Centers and Universities: MIT, Harvard University, Boston College, Tufts University, Boston University, Northeastern University,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ory, National Bureau of Economic Research, Broad Institute, Lowell Center for Space Science & Technology, National Emerging Infectious Diseases Laboratories
